Going in for C Section in about an hour 🙃 by ScheduleLast8818 in PregnancyUK

[–]DueNebula1228 2 points3 points  (0 children)

Yes, mine wasn’t planned but it’s still nerve wracking when they are prepping you. They are really efficient but you almost feel like you’re between life and death on that table. The reassuring part is that you don’t feel a thing. It’s super quick when they take the baby out, the after bit is super long when they close you up. You can play whatever you want in there in terms what you like to listen to. They allow your partner in there with you which helps and if they are good at distracting you.
